Release checklist — item 7: Barcode scanner handoff

Before shipping, plug a Wrenfield scanner into the staging kiosk and scan the three test labels taped inside the hardware bin. All three should land in the Tallyport intake screen within a second. If scans show up doubled, the debounce setting regressed — flag it, don't ship. Record the build you tested against below.

pipeline stamp: htk9_ce63042d9

**Mgmt Meeting Minutes — Retiring the Brightline Range**

Quick recap for sales leads at Fenholt Supplies: we agreed to retire the Brightline fixture range by year-end. Remaining stock moves to clearance pricing next month, and accounts on standing orders get migrated to the Lumetta range. Trade-in incentives were approved in principle. The confidential note on next steps sits just below.

board note of bajof-bajeg: The pricing group signed off on a budget of $13.4 million for Project Sildor. The renewal with Lamixek Holdings closes at $48.9 million a year, 49 percent above the last contract.

Subject: Websocket reconnect fix — cut-over summary

Welcome, new folks. Last night we cut over the Glimmerline gateway fix for the reconnect storm bug: clients no longer retried instantly after a dropped socket, which had been overwhelming the edge tier. Backoff with jitter is now enforced server-side. Reconnect rates look healthy. The gateway now runs with these values:

settings of tagef-bawif:
DRUIX_HOST=druix.zemvarlabs.internal
DRUIX_PORT=8000